How the Concept Works in Practical Terms
At its core, the Police and Fire Credit Union Philadelphia Advantages and Benefits Explained represents a member-owned financial cooperative rather than a traditional for-profit bank. Members typically include active and retired police officers, firefighters, and sometimes their immediate families, creating a shared community bond. Because profits are returned to members in the form of lower fees, higher savings yields, and more competitive loan rates, the structure encourages long term relationships over transactional interactions. The membership process usually involves providing proof of employment or eligibility, followed by opening a basic savings account, which then grants access to a range of services.

Exploring the Police and Fire Credit Union Philadelphia Advantages and Benefits Explained means weighing tangible benefits against realistic expectations. On the positive side, members often enjoy lower overdraft fees, reduced loan interest rates, and personalized service from staff who understand the profession. Financial education resources tailored for first responders and their families can also be a valuable, though sometimes overlooked, advantage. However, it is important to note that membership is restricted, which means not every Philadelphia resident can join. Additionally, technology offerings such as mobile apps may vary in sophistication compared with larger national banks, so personal preferences play a role in satisfaction.
